Game data

Configuration file(s) location

System Location
Windows %USERPROFILE%\Documents\Spiderweb Software\Avernum Saved Games\AvernumSettings.dat
macOS (OS X)
Steam Play (Linux) <Steam-folder>/steamapps/compatdata/208400/pfx/[Note 1]

Save game data location

System Location
Windows %USERPROFILE%\Documents\Spiderweb Software\Avernum Saved Games\
macOS (OS X) $HOME/Library/Application Support/Spiderweb Software/Avernum Saved Games/
~/Library/Containers/com.spiderwebsoftware.Avernum/Data/Library/Application Support/Spiderweb Software/Avernum Saved Games/
Steam Play (Linux) <Steam-folder>/steamapps/compatdata/208400/pfx/[Note 1]
For all versions saves are labelled Save0, Save1, etc.[2]

OS X

Game Playing Slowly

Change around settings[3]
Press Shift+D, enter fps, and check if your FPS is unsatisfactory. If so, do the following:
  1. Run as few other programs as possible in the background.
  2. On the Video Mode window that comes up when you launch the game, choose to play in a window and then select a small size for the window. Alternately, run the game, select Game Options on the title screen, and set Game Area Size to Small.
  3. Run the game, select Game Options on the title screen, and set Graphics Extra Details to Don't Draw.

General

Killed Khoth and Unable to Progress

Enter a cheat code, you cheater[1]
  1. Press Shift and D
  2. Enter sdf 55 14 1
  3. Press OK
